security/fix: Final review corrections for Ethernet runtime config

Security fixes:
- IP validation: bounds checking for octets (0-255)
- ETH.config() return value now checked with distinct logging
- set ip 0.0.0.0 now enables DHCP (was rejected before)

Documentation:
- Fixed typo: 'thevalue' → 'the value'
- Added missing: advert.zerohop command documentation
- Clarified IP configuration behavior (DHCP, ETH_STATIC_IP fallback, reset to DHCP)

All identified issues addressed or documented as out-of-scope.
